X-Arcades are decent, but if you're going to be building your own cab anyway you should just build your own controls as well. You can find tons of tutorials on the net; I recommend you go with either Happ or Sanwa for the parts (matter of preference), and use a J-pac (www.ultimarc.com...) for the encoder. You'll save money and end up with a higher quality setup.

I would build your own control board . As suggested by it, get the keyboard encoder from Ultimarc (http://www.ultimarc.com..., get Joysticks and buttons from Happs (http://www.happcontrols.com/...). I really enjoy their Competition 8-way joysticks, the are very nice for fighters and general play.

If you need any help with the wiring, I and I'm sure others here have some experience. It is very easy to do and very rewarding to make your own.
